Ghana in talks with Nigeria, Benin to bid for 2025 AFCON- Sports Minister

Ghana Sports Minster, Mustapha Ussif, has stated there have been discussions for Ghana to bid for rights to host the 2025 Total Energies African Cup of Nations (AFCON).

He said this in an interview with Citi Sports on the sidelines of the National Team Day Walk with the Legends event put together to raise awareness of the Black Stars’ upcoming campaign at the 2022 FIFA World Cup in Qatar.

Guinea won the rights to host the 2025 continental football tournament but African football’s governing body, CAF, recently stripped the West African nation of the hosting rights for the competition.

CAF has gone ahead to open bids to host the tournament and according to the Sports Minister, there have been discussions to decide whether Ghana would like to co-host the tournament.

“There’s a discussion that Ghana should bid with the likes of Nigeria and Benin. We are still considering it. We have not taken a decision yet but there is that discussion that we should get sister countries so that we can put in that bid.”

Interested countries have up to November 11 to officially declare their interest to host the 2025 AFCON and November 16 is the deadline for submission of related documents.

Ghana last hosted the tournament in 2008 in four cities Accra, Kumasi, Sekondi-Takoradi and Tamale.
